  • Question about Puerto Rican Spanish 'Bomba De Gasolina' (Gas Station)?

    It seems that 'gasolinera' is becoming the more common word for "gas station / filling station" in Spanish speaking countries. Yet, a book on Puerto Rican Spanish I once read published in 1964 lists 'bomba' for Colombia and 'bomba de gasolina' for Puerto Rico. 'Bomba' can also mean "pump" in Spanish. I was wondering how often the word (bomba de gasolina) is still used by Puerto Ricans? Is it considered just slang? Nowadays, I see Puerto Rican writers and bloggers on the Internet using 'gasolinera' or 'estación de servicio' almost exclusively. Thanks for any help and information. Really appreciate it!

  • What Is A Raincoat Called In Puertorrican Spanish?

    The standard Spanish word for raincoat is "impermeable" yet there seem to be a lot of regional words used in Spanish too. A Mexican lady once told me that she called it "La managa de hule." I've read that capa de agua, gabardina and piloto are also used in various places in Spain and Latin America. A few sources I've looked at mention capa and capa de lluvia for Puerto Rico. Is this true? If any Puertorrican (Boricua) speaker of Spanish can fill me in on this I would really appreciate it. Garcias / Thanks!
